    I have noticed Tacos Chilo's on 50th Street just east of MacArthur (next to Marcos Pizza) many times when I pull into either Charm or Abels and I've wondered. Is it worth sacrificing an Abels trip to try it? I finally bit the bullet yesterday and headed in. It was worth it. The menu is limited but the prices are fantastic!  I've found sometimes that a small menu means that the few  things on it are done really well as they are at Tacos Chilo's. First visit we tried the flautas (you get 5) which are covered in a salad topped with crema and fresh cheese with a side of sliced avocado and tomatoes. and the mulita (sort of like a quesadilla with corn tortillas. The tortillas are obviously handmade and delicious! They are lightly fried until they puff a bit and then are filled with carne asada (my choice) onions, cilantro and a hunk of avocado. The meat choices (shown on the back of the menu) for most of the dishes are asada (beef), pastor (pork), higado (cow liver), lechon (soft pork) and pollo (chicken). Menudo and Birria is offered daily I believe for fans of those. Only reason I gave it a 4* is the limits. My husband wanted pepper but they don't have it. There are no public restrooms. The two sauces offered are good but if you wanted more heat, there were no salsas offered, but just a kind of watered salsa verde and tabasco sauce. However I learned you can ask for regular or spicy salsa on my 2nd visit. Overall I really liked it.

    This place is definitely a gem and is newish (I think), so please show them some love. I've had the enchiladas twice now and am obsessed. The potatoes that come with them have such a buttery texture and special subtle flavor--seriously some of the best potatoes I've ever had. Everything we've tried there has been super fresh and delicious in a way that's surprising. The cheese in the enchiladas tastes really fresh. The pineapple aguas frescas was fresh and made in house. The taco sides such as radishes, limes, and peppers/carrots are also high quality and super fresh. The portions are a good size so you're not asking for a food coma when you leave, in addition to the meal not being heavy in general. The atmosphere is comfortable, clean and relaxed as well. We even got it to-go once and everything was boxed up perfectly.
